Coronavirus infections are declining in Saudi Arabia with the Health Ministry registering 898 new cases on Tuesday.

In a daily briefing on the outbreak, it said that the tally has reached 316,670.

It reported 718 more recoveries, raising the total to 291,514.

Fatalities climbed to 3,929 after 32 more people succumbed to the disease.

Saudi Arabia's King Salman Humanitarian Aid and Relief Center (KSrelief) dispatched on Saturday the seventh relief plane to Lebanon from Riyadh's King Khalid International Airport.

The aircraft is carrying essential supplies, including food, medical aid, and shelter material, to assist the Lebanese people during the ongoing crisis.

The humanitarian initiative is in line with the directives of Custodian of the Two Holy Mosques King Salman bin Abdulaziz Al Saud and Prince Mohammed bin Salman bin Abdulaziz Al Saud, Crown Prince and Prime Minister.

The Kingdom’s assistance to Lebanon to alleviate the suffering of the people affected by the current situation reflects its commitment to humanitarian principles.
